TÜRİB to Launch Futures Market by Year-End

The Turkey Products Exchange (TÜRİB) aims to launch its futures market, starting with wheat and corn contracts, by the end of the year.

A New Era in Agricultural Futures Trading

The futures market, targeted to be launched by the end of the year by the Turkey Products Exchange (TÜRİB), was presented to the public at a promotional meeting hosted by the Izmir Commodity Exchange (ICX). Speaking at the opening of the meeting, ICX Chairman Işınsu Kestelli emphasized the importance of organized markets in agricultural risk management and made the following assessment:

"For a more competitive agricultural sector, we must better manage price risks. Today, a significant step in this process is being taken in Izmir. Our task from now on is to develop this market together, explain it correctly, and align it with the real needs of the sector."

Market Structure and Delivery Plan

Sharing details about the technical operation of the market during the panel, TÜRİB General Manager Ali Kırali stated that they plan to start with wheat and corn products in the first phase. TÜRİB General Manager Ali Kırali made the following statement regarding the system's flexible structure:

"We plan to start primarily with wheat and corn products. Contracts based on Electronic Product Certificates (ELÜS) are designed for physical delivery, while index-based contracts are designed for cash settlement. Konya is considered as the initial physical delivery point due to its central location in terms of logistics and being a major grain-producing region. We have created a flexible infrastructure that allows for the addition of more underlying assets and delivery points later on."
